Andrew Warren has a diverse work experience in the field of journalism. Andrew began their career at Bullivant Media as a rugby reporter, where they covered a wide range of news and sports, including the Worcester Warriors in rugby's Premiership. Andrew then moved on to roles at the Swindon Advertiser as a sports reporter and later as the Deputy Sports Editor. In 2014, they became the Joint Head of Sport at Total Sport Swindon. Andrew then joined Archant as a digital reporter, before working as a sports journalist at MailOnline. In 2017, they joined East Anglian Daily Times as an Ipswich Town writer. Currently, they hold the position of Media And Communications Lead at Ipswich Town FC.
Andrew Warren completed their Bachelor of Arts degree in Journalism from De Montfort University in 2008. Andrew later pursued a Post Graduate Diploma in Journalism from the same university in 2009.

Ipswich Town Football Club, founded in 1878, boasts the most successful history of any club in eastern England. Most notably, the Club has won three major trophies (English Division 1 Title in 1962, FA Cup in 1978, UEFA Cup in 1981) under the guidance of managers Sir Alf Ramsey and Sir Bobby Robson. The stadium at Portman Road welcomes our loyal fan base each match day, as well as playing host to an array of other events and initiatives throughout the year. The Club is a seven-day-a-week venue, offering match day hospitality along with the use of the facilities on non-match days for conferencing and events. Activities and opportunities are diverse, ranging from advertising and sponsorship through to the various commercial events hosted including golf days, dinners and concerts. Then of course there's retail, with our ever-popular Planet Blue store. Ipswich Town is also renowned for its Academy (based at Playford Road), where future first team players are nurtured, as well as a flourishing Women’s Programme. The official Club lottery schemes generate funds for the Academy and youth player development, too. The ITFC Community Trust works to further strengthen the Club’s relationship with the communities that it serves.
